Body Language
Characters may spend 1 skill point to gain access to body language, the same way they can learn any other language.
A character that knows body language gains a +2 to Sense Motive checks and social skill checks when it can see its interlocutor and its body movements are relevant. This bonus applies only when interacting with creatures with the same body type as the character, but spending an additional skill point allows the character to apply this bonus always.
DMs may rule that the same restriction regarding body types applies to different cultures that have completely unique body language.
